Regarding this, are Peaches pink?

From the outside, yellow and white peaches are distinguished by their skin color – deep yellow with a red or pink blush for the former versus pale and pink for the latter. Inside, the golden flesh of the yellow peach is more acidic, with a tartness that mellows as the peach ripens and softens.

What is the taste of peach?

Peaches with white flesh typically are very sweet with little acidity, while yellow-fleshed peaches typically have an acidic tang coupled with a sweet floral taste (sometimes described as the classic peach taste, which mellows as the peach ripens and softens), red fleshed varieties are typically flavourful and tangy

Is it normal for a peach to be red inside?

The flesh will cling to large central seed, and is often stained the same deep red as the skin. Blood peaches are sweet when fully ripe, and can be more acidic and tart when under-ripe. They are said to have a taste unlike most peach varieties.

Should you refrigerate peaches?

Tree-ripe peaches can be refrigerated for 2-3 days without loss of quality or taste. Do not refrigerate unripe peaches. Leave them stem down on the counter at room temp to ripen before refrigerating.

Can you eat a peach that isn't ripe?

The problem with unripe peaches Picked peaches can soften over time, but they will not continue to produce sugar. The sticky natural sugar is the reason why fresh peaches make the best desserts. That unripe peach might also feel hard and stringy when you bite into it.

Is Peach a shade of pink or orange?

Peach can also be described as a pale, pinkish-yellow. Most shades of peach are warm shades of pink-orange. Pantone's peach shades run from rosy, mostly pink colors to predominantly orange hues. Some shades have a dusty or grayish tint while others tend towards brown or nude.

Is Peach a citrus?

Are peaches considered a citrus fruit? No. Citrus fruits are lemons, limes, oranges, clementines, tangerines and grapefruit and the like. Peaches do contain citric acid, but much lower amounts.

What is a white peach called?

Unlike their yellow-fleshed cousins, white peaches (Prunus persica) boast a creamy pinkish-white flesh that is sweeter to taste and low in acidity.
